Proposal
Change of use from Class C3 (residential) to Class C4 (small house of multiple occupation) to provide 4 HMO rooms, involving the erection of a single storey rear extension, conversion of the attached flank garage into habitable rooms and alterations to ground floor front, flank and rear fenestrations.
As published by the council, reference DM2026/00391

About full applications
A full application seeks permission for a complete, detailed proposal in one go, with siting, design, access and landscaping all fixed at this stage. More in our guide to planning application types.
